    Key Chemical Properties of Sodium L-Aspartate

    Sodium L-Aspartate is the sodium salt of L-aspartic acid. It is supplied as a crystalline, readily water-soluble powder. Its defined composition and high solubility make it particularly suitable for aqueous formulations, cell culture media and biotechnological processes.

    • Chemical name: Sodium L-Aspartate
    • CAS No.: 323194-76-9
    • Chemical formula: C₄H₆NNaO₄ · H₂O
    • Appearance: Crystalline powder
    • Solubility: More than 100 g/l in water at 20 °C
    • Molecular weight: 173.1 g/mol
    • Sodium content: Approximately 13%

    The actual solubility in an application may be influenced by concentration, temperature, pH and other formulation components.

    Biopharmaceutical and Biotechnology Industry

    In the biopharmaceutical industry, Sodium L-Aspartate DPL-BioPharm grade is used as an amino acid component in cell culture media and upstream bioprocessing. Aspartic acid is an important building block in cell metabolism and supports the growth and functionality of cultured cells.

    The sodium salt offers significantly improved water solubility compared with poorly soluble amino acid forms. This facilitates the preparation of concentrated stock solutions and defined culture media used in biopharmaceutical production.

    Typical applications include:

    • Cell culture media
    • Fermentation processes
    • Upstream bioprocessing
    • Preparation of amino acid stock solutions
    • Production of biopharmaceutical active ingredients

    The appropriate concentration depends on the cell line, microorganism, production system and desired process conditions. Careful formulation of the culture medium is therefore essential for reproducible cell growth and production performance.

    Cell Culture Media and Fermentation Processes

    Sodium L-Aspartate can serve as a defined source of L-aspartate in media for mammalian cells, microorganisms and other biological expression systems. Its high water solubility supports homogeneous distribution within the culture medium and can simplify the preparation of liquid concentrates.

    In fermentation and cell culture processes, amino acids are used as nutrients and metabolic building blocks. Their precise concentration can influence cell growth, productivity and the formation of the desired biological product.

    Sodium L-Aspartate in bioprocess applications:

    • provides a readily soluble source of L-aspartate.
    • supports the formulation of defined cell culture media.
    • can be used in concentrated media feeds and stock solutions.

    Process suitability and concentration should always be confirmed for the individual cell line and manufacturing process.

    Research and Specialty Chemical Applications

    In addition to biopharmaceutical applications, chemically pure Sodium L-Aspartate can be evaluated as a defined amino acid salt for laboratory, research and specialty chemical formulations.
    Its high solubility and specified chemical composition are advantageous when reproducible aqueous solutions are required. It may also be used as a raw material in the development of amino acid derivatives or specialized chemical formulations.

    Possible applications include:

    • Biochemical research
    • Laboratory reagent formulations
    • Chemical synthesis and process development
    • Preparation of defined aqueous solutions
    • Development of amino acid-based compounds
